FormFactor Inc. Reports Strong Q3 2024 Results: A Leap Forward in Semiconductor Testing Technology

Last updated: November 05, 2024
Taurigo

FormFactor Inc., a key player in the semiconductor industry, has released its financial results for the third quarter of 2024. The company, headquartered in Livermore, California, continues to demonstrate robust growth and strategic transformation as it navigates the complexities of the semiconductor market. The results reflect significant advancements in both revenue and profitability, with notable contributions from its two reportable segments: Probe Cards and Systems.

1. Financial Performance Overview

In Q3 2024, FormFactor reported a net income of $18.73 million, a substantial increase from the $4.37 million reported in Q3 2023. This remarkable growth can be attributed to enhanced operational efficiencies and increased demand for its semiconductor test and measurement products.

Key Financial Metrics

  • Revenue: FormFactor achieved revenues of $207.9 million in Q3 2024, a notable rise from $171.5 million in the prior year.
  • Operating Income: The operating income increased to $17.85 million in Q3 2024, compared to $2.70 million in Q3 2023.
  • Gross Margin: The company's gross profit grew by 14.1%, resulting in a gross margin of 14.3% for the quarter.

2. Revenue Breakdown by Segment

The company's revenue is primarily derived from two segments: Probe Cards and Systems.

  • Probe Cards: This segment generated $207.9 million in revenue, accounting for the majority of total sales, and showcased a 34.5% increase compared to the same quarter last year.
  • Systems: Revenue from this segment was $23.9 million, reflecting steady demand despite the divestiture of the FRT Metrology business.

Product Performance

  • Foundry & Logic Products: Revenue increased by 34.5% year-over-year for the three months ending September 28, 2024.
  • DRAM Products: This segment saw an impressive surge in revenue, increasing by 63.4% year-over-year.
  • Flash Products: Revenue grew by 21.1% compared to Q3 2023.

3. Geographic Revenue Distribution

FormFactor's geographical revenue distribution highlights its strong global presence:

  • Asia-Pacific: $143.4 million in revenue.
  • Americas: $123.4 million in revenue.
  • Europe, Middle East, and Africa: $43.2 million in revenue.

This diversified revenue stream underscores the company’s ability to adapt to varying market conditions across regions.

4. Strategic Developments and Acquisitions

In an important strategic move, FormFactor completed the sale of its China operations, recognizing a gain of $20.3 million. This transaction, along with the establishment of an exclusive distribution agreement, positions the company for sustained growth in the Asia-Pacific market.

The sale of the FRT Metrology business in late 2023 signifies a shift in focus towards core products that enhance profitability and operational efficiency.

5. Operating Expenses and Investments

FormFactor has maintained a disciplined approach to expenses. Research and development (R&D) expenses rose by 12.5% in Q3 2024, reflecting the company's commitment to innovation in semiconductor testing technologies. Selling, general, and administrative expenses increased by 6.3%, indicating robust operational support for growth initiatives.

Cash Flow Insights

The net change in cash for Q3 2024 was a decrease of $13.46 million, influenced by investments in productive assets and stock repurchase activities. The cash flow from operating activities was positive at $26.73 million, indicating strong operational health.

6. Financial Position

FormFactor's balance sheet shows a solid financial position with total assets at $1.15 billion, up from $1.03 billion year-over-year. Total equity increased to $955.0 million, reflecting strong retained earnings.
